| A study by Stanford University concluded that 45% of college | ||||||
| students sleep at least 8 hours per night. In a sample | ||||||
| of 10 DCCC students, find the probability that | ||||||
| at least 8 of the 10 get 8 or more. | ||||||
Solution:
Here, we have to use binomial distribution formula for finding the required probability.
We are given
p = 0.45,
q = 1 – p = 1 – 0.45 = 0.55
n = 10,
We have to find P(X≥8)
P(X≥8) = P(X=8) + P(X=9) + P(X=10)
P(X=x) = nCx*p^x*q^(n – x)
P(X=8) = 10C8*0.45^8*0.55^(10 – 8)
P(X=8) = 45*0.45^8*0.55^2
P(X=8) = 0.02289
P(X=9) = 10C9*0.45^9*0.55^(10 – 9)
P(X=9) = 10*0.45^9*0.55^1
P(X=9) = 0.004162
P(X=10) = 10C10*0.45^10*0.55^(10 – 10)
P(X=10) = 1*0.45^10*0.55^0
P(X=10) = 0.000341
P(X≥8) = P(X=8) + P(X=9) + P(X=10)
P(X≥8) = 0.02289 + 0.004162 + 0.000341
P(X≥8) = 0.027393
Required probability = 0.027393
